Nico Schrijver's book reviews the genesis, meaning, and legal status of the concept of sustainable development within public international law. It examines the legal principles that have emerged and assesses the integration of sustainable development across fields of international law as urged by major summit documents. The text is based on a course given at the Hague Academy of International Law.
